Profession: DevOps-ingeniør - kursus 95.000 gnid. fra ProductStar, træning 8 måneder, Dato 29. november 2023.
Miscellanea / / November 29, 2023
- Vi finder et job til dig under dit studie eller refunderer dine penge.
- Kursets skabere og foredragsholdere er eksperter fra Amazon, Yandex og Skyeng
- Varighed: 8 måneder. (mulighed for intensiv træning)
- Niveau: fra bunden
- Format: online
- Rentefri afdragsordning for Rusland og Kasakhstan
Hvad vil du lære
Grundlæggende om DevOps
Studer DevOps tilgang og metodologi, grundlæggende koncepter, stadier af livscyklussen og softwareudvikling ved hjælp af casestudier
Git og Gitlab
Git og introduktion til versionskontrolsystemer, oprettelse af filialer, grundlæggende koncepter, kloning, fletning, fletning
Grundlæggende om Python
Grundlæggende syntaks, strengformatering, følge, forgrening og looping, oprettelse og brug af funktioner
Pakkeapplikationer i Docker
Avancerede Docker-muligheder, applikationspakketilgange og praktisk kompetenceudvikling
Vi beskæftiger mere end 80 % af de studerende under deres studier
Rigtige sager til din portefølje
Vi hjælper dig med at udføre praktiske opgaver ved hjælp af rigtige cases til at præsentere dine resultater ved et interview.
Praktik i virksomheder
Vi arrangerer deltidspraktik i partnervirksomheder
CV-skrivning og samtaleforberedelse
Vores karrierecenter hjælper dig med at samle din erfaring og afsluttede projekter til et anstændigt CV, samt forberede dig til samtaler og bestå en praksissamtale
Interview træning
Vi hjælper dig med at forberede dig til din jobsamtale og træner på en speciel simulator med en mentor.
Hjælp under prøvetiden
En karrierecenterspecialist hjælper dig med at forblive på prøve efter ansættelse
Forsvar af det afsluttende projekt
Du præsenterer dine afgangsprojekter og præstationer for et udvalg af potentielle arbejdsgivere
3
RuteLeder af DevOps, VTB Internet Bank
Han er engageret i udviklingen af infrastrukturkodeks og transformation af processerne i virksomheder, som han arbejder i - og formidler aktivt DevOps-metoden og Infrastructure as a Code-tilgangen. Mener at DevOps begynder med ledelse. I sit arbejde bruger hun aktivt værktøjer som Ansible, Gitlab CI, Jenkins, Terraform og andre Hashicorp-produkter. Holder sig nøje til doktrinen om, at alt skal være korrekt beskrevet for maksimal genbrug og hurtig indlæring. Han skriver en ph.d.-afhandling om problemerne med at implementere DevOps i virksomheder, og udgiver videnskabelige artikler om emnerne DevOps, CI/CD og informationssikkerhedsproblemer (DevSecOps). Som en del af et projekt med en videnskabelig vejleder hjælper han også med at åbne en DevOps-retning for mastergrader på ITMO. Han er mentor og ekspert ved St. Petersburg State University startup accelerator "allthewayup startup hub".
Niveau 1: "Grundlæggende DevOps-færdigheder"
Øvelse på sager om rigtige virksomheder, assistance til praktikophold og første samtaler.
Blok 1: DevOps Basics
Klasser:
Introduktion til DevOps
Blok 2: Linux Basics og Arbejde med Bash
Linux: Introduktion og grundlæggende OS-koncepter
Bash. Grundlæggende scriptværktøj i Linux
Blok 3: CI/CD-systemer
Software livscyklus, CI/CD
Blok 4: Git og Gitlab versionskontrolsystemer
Introduktion til Git og GitLab
Introduktion til GitLab CI
GitLab CI: interne variabler, artefakter, regler
Blok 5: Arbejde med Docker
Containerisering. Introduktion til Docker.
Pakkeapplikationer i Docker
Docker Compose. Tjenester og interaktioner
Blok 6: Konfigurationsstyring, Ansible
Ansible. Grundlæggende begreber og kommandoer
Ansible. Roller og variabler
Ansible. Rolleudvikling
Blok 7: SQL Fundamentals for DevOps
Introduktion til SQL Block
Dataudtræk og filtrering: indgangsniveau
Dataudtræk og filtrering: Avanceret
Transformering og sortering af data: indgangsniveau
Transformering og sortering af data: avanceret niveau
Enhed 8: SQL og databaser
Gruppering af data
Introduktion til databaser
Sammenføjning af borde
Underforespørgsler
Underforespørgsler JOIN og WHERE
Opdatering, tilføjelse og sletning af data
Oprettelse, ændring og sletning af tabeller
Tekstoperationer og vinduesfunktioner
Forespørgselsacceleration og -optimering, tabeludtryk
Hands-on LEGO projekt
Oversigt over hovedprogrammer
Blok 9: Python til DevOps
Introduktion til Python
Datatyper, funktioner, klasser, fejl
Strenge, betingelser, sløjfer
Python til Devops
Blok 10: Avanceret: MLOps - DevOps in the World of Machine Learning
Metoder til big data-analyse og teamorganisering. CRISP-DM
Forbedring af kvaliteten af arbejdet med data
Blok 11: Avanceret: Cloud Services og Hadoop
Grundlæggende om Hadoop og MapReduce
Grundlæggende om Big Data